This study proposed to analyze chloramphenicol (CPA), sulfamethoxazole (SMX), and sulfanilamide (SNA) drugs by reverse-phase liquid chromatography method in the form of pharmaceutical preparations and synthetic mixture. For this method, column C18-ODS (25 cm x 4.6 mm) was used with an isocratic elution mobile phase composed of methanol and 2% orthophosphoric acid, fluorescent detector (Ex= 310 nm, Em= 440 nm). It was found that the time of retention for CPA, SMX, and SNA was 8.99 ± 0.02, 10.76 ± 0.2, and 8.21 ± 0.2 min, respectively. Liposomes were synthesized using the thin film method. A lyophilized power of egg-derived phosphatidylcholine, stearylamine, and cholesterol were added to ethanol and dried under argon to form a lipid cake. The lipid cake was rehydrated with dPBS and sonicated at 60°C forming a heterogenous batch of liposomes. Our results revealed the average size of the liposomes, determined by Dynamic Light Scattering, was approximately 223.1nm, while demonstrating a weakly positive zeta-potential of 1.9± 8.07mv. The United States faces several ongoing public health issues including the opioid epidemic. This article describes a new model aimed at providing a framework that incorporates the United Nations (UN) Sustainable Development Goals (SDGs) to develop pharmacy student leaders through education, experiences, and development of critical skills. This holistic approach can serve as an example methodology to equip future leaders across public health domains to tackle many of the critical problems we face today.
